About the Role

We are looking for a Senior Social Lead (Director level) to lead the development and execution of social-first strategies that drive engagement and build brands across the digital ecosystem. They will own full-year social and content roadmaps, shaping how brands show up across platforms and key cultural moments. They will build and evolve strategic frameworks that connect cultural calendars, campaign tentpoles, and always-on content—balancing proactive planning with real-time, reactive opportunities. They will also translate data, performance insights, and audience behavior into clear strategic direction, informing content systems and creative territories. This person will partner closely with creative, media, and analytics teams to develop insight-led briefs and guide execution, ensuring work is both culturally relevant and performance-driven. Additionally, they will mentor and develop junior team members, fostering a strong, collaborative team environment. They will stay ahead of trends, identifying new opportunities for brands to show up in meaningful and differentiated ways.
